10. Cryptocurrency-Specific Disclaimers

10.1 Market Volatility

Cryptocurrency markets are highly volatile. Tax calculations and planning:

  • Reflect values at specific points in time
  • May change significantly with market movements
  • Require regular review and updates
  • Cannot predict future tax implications of current positions

We recommend regular tax reviews for active cryptocurrency holders.

10.2 Regulatory Evolution

Cryptocurrency taxation regulations are rapidly evolving:

  • HMRC regularly updates and clarifies guidance
  • New transaction types may lack clear tax treatment
  • International standards are still developing
  • Court decisions may establish new precedents

We adapt to regulatory changes but cannot predict future developments.

10.3 Technology Risks

Cryptocurrency transactions involve technology-specific risks:

  • Blockchain data may contain errors or omissions
  • Exchange data may be incomplete or incorrect
  • Wallet transaction histories may be unavailable
  • Smart contract interactions may be complex to classify

12.2 Anti-Money Laundering (AML)

As an HMRC-supervised business for AML purposes, we are required to:

  • Conduct Customer Due Diligence (CDD) on all clients
  • Verify identity and source of funds where applicable
  • Report suspicious activities as required by law
  • Maintain records in accordance with Money Laundering Regulations 2017
